Residents of Sḵwx̱wú7mesh Úxwumixw have voted overwhelmingly in favour of “reclaiming schooling,” infusing Sḵwx̱wú7mesh worldviews and land-based studying into college curriculum.
The Squamish Nation in B.C., held a referendum on the subject final month, with 87.5 per cent of voters green-lighting the proposal to enter a brand new instructional jurisdiction settlement with the federal authorities.
It can now embark on a mission to develop its personal schooling legislation, releasing itself from 5 sections of the Indian Act that give Ottawa decision-making energy over Indigenous youngsters and faculties
“It’s so uplifting as a result of it’s not solely our elders which can be talking their minds, they’re those which can be instructing us, passing down that information,” mentioned Squamish Coun. Wilson Williams in an interview.
“That is what we’re telling our younger ones within the faculties.”

Traditionally, Canada’s colonial leaders sought to eradicate Indigenous identities, languages and cultures throughout the nation, and with Christian church buildings, used the residential college system to try to accomplish their purpose.
Now, Squamish methods of schooling — s7ulh wa nexwniw̓ éyalh within the Sḵwx̱wú7mesh sníchim language — intention to empower the nation’s youngsters with the information settlers tried to steal from their ancestors.
“Coming from two mother and father which can be residential college survivors, I by no means was launched to the language at residence,” Williams informed World Information.
“We’ve robust legends of how far our folks have come and travelled, and overcome a lot … these are the oral histories that we all know now, nevertheless it additionally means we’re regaining that again.”

As soon as the brand new schooling legislation is in place, Sḵwx̱wú7mesh Úxwumixw will management faculties and schooling on its reserve from preschool to Grade 12, utilizing its personal qualification course of for academics, and creating its personal commencement requirements and necessities.
The system shall be streamlined so college students can switch to an equal grade within the public system as effectively, based on an info sheet on the nation’s web site. The nation may even guarantee its requirements are on par with different faculties, whereas empowering youngsters to embrace their items in a non-colonial setting.
“Our survival, pre-colonialism, was about figuring out folks’s items at a younger age to say, ‘You’re a hunter.’ We’re going to embrace that,” Williams defined. “That’s how we use to construct capability.”

Squamish residents will be capable of select whether or not or to not ship their youngsters to colleges it runs, the data sheet states, and new faculties shall be constructed because of the approval.
“We’ll be growing stronger relationships, not simply with our households and communities … however with exterior entities as effectively, whether or not it’s college programs, the federal government system, the provincial or federal governments,” mentioned Williams.
Language shall be on the forefront of schooling for older college students, he added. The nation additionally expects the formal adoption of s7ulh wa nexwniw̓ éyalh within the schooling system will enhance its commencement charges.

Schooling Minister Rachna Singh mentioned the provincial authorities absolutely helps the nation’s transfer to self-governing schooling.
“I felt extraordinarily inspired after I noticed that information, particularly coming from the earlier position I had because the parliamentary secretary for anti-racism,” she informed World Information.
“I understand how necessary self-governance and self-determination is for these nations.”
The ministry will help Squamish Nation in “each attainable approach,” she added.
